Telemarketers generally require a high school diploma or GED. A bachelor's degree is a bonus.
Certifications are not required, but they can better showcase your skills and increase your chances of landing your desired job.
Job Outlook
Accordingly to the CollegeGrad LLC, the job outlook for telemarketers is expected to decline by about 3% from 2014-2024.
Average Salary
The average salary for a telemarketer is $28,550,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ics.
